Title of article :
Investigation of liquid-crystalline behaviour of copper octakisalkylthiophthalocyanine and its film properties

Abstract :
The mesogenic properties of copper octakisalkylthiophthalocyanine [(C6S)8PcCu] were studied by differential scanning calorimetry (DSC), X-ray and optical microscopy. This phthalocyanine forms columnar hexagonal (Colh) mesophase. Thin films of (C6S)8PcCu were prepared by spin-coating technique. Thermally induced molecular reorganization within the films was studied by the methods of ellipsometry and UV–Vis absorption spectroscopy. Heat treatment produces molecular ordering which is believed to be due to stacking interaction between neighbouring phthalocyanine moieties. The differences in structural organization of the heated and unheated films were stated. These differences in structural organization in their turn are found to influence the electrical properties of the films.
